International Women's Day
I am not sure if it is because I am getting older and wiser but now I just see how far behind women are from achieving any thing resembling equality. Possibly in other decades I was busy with work, starting a family or I am not really sure why but now it is so glaringly obvious every day. Yesterday, I found out an ex colleague of mine had been given a Headship of a school. He started the year after me in one of my previous schools. He was infamous for coming in smelling of booze and somedays it was questioned if not straight from a bar. Within a year he was promoted, and within five he has gone through the ranks and been given a school to Head next year. I then thought of so many other examples of the same thing, and I thought of all the people I have worked with, most of my women friends have stayed in the same jobs or been given a token middle managed positions over the years, whereas many males have progressed through management. I am passed over all the time, in meetings my opinions or thoughts are looked over and I know most people are totally unaware of it. This might be my experience as my subject if usually dominated by male teachers but I suspect it is not. This morning I presented a riddle to the students where the answer was the CEO was a women. And still no one got the answer. But I cannot fault them, yesterday I was looking at a Maths blog by Dr. Austin, and I assumed wrongly she was a man. When will it change?! Will it change?! I am certainly going to do my bit by trying to educate Sebastian on the issue. Anyways... Happy International Women's Day!
